This year we have a full slate of NFL games to keep you occupied over the holiday weekend, including the San Francisco 49ers, at home against the Washington Commanders.

The 49ers haven’t played against the Washington-based franchise since 2020, losing to the then Washington Football team, 23-15. San Francisco holds the all-time record over their NFC counterparts though, at a record of 21-12-1 since the teams’ first meeting in 1952. In the two teams’ last meeting, Washington came with the win, 23-15, over San Francisco.

Despite the 49ers already clinching the division, don’t expect them to take their foot off the gas down the stretch run of the regular season. Only a game back on the Minnesota Vikings, the Red & Gold will look to secure even more of a home-field advantage in the final three games, using most of their starters to do so.

What time does the Week 16 game start?

Kickoff is set for 1:05 p.m. PST on Saturday, Dec. 24th, at Levi’s Stadium in Santa Clara, California.

Where can I watch the game?

The game will air live on CBS. Kevin Harlan (play-by-play) and Trent Green (color analyst) will be on the call. Melanie Collins (sideline reporters) will join them.
